上海知名企业招聘web前端工程师要求

在当今互联网时代,Web前端工程师已经成为企业争抢的香饽饽。上海,作为我国的经济中心,更是汇聚了众多知名企业。那么,这些知名企业对Web前端工程师有哪些具体要求呢?本文将为您详细解析。

一、技术栈要求

  1. HTML5:熟练掌握HTML5标签、属性和语义化标签,了解HTML5新特性,如Canvas、SVG、Web Worker等。

  2. CSS3:熟练运用CSS3进行页面布局,掌握盒模型、浮动、定位、响应式设计等,了解CSS预处理器如Sass、Less等。

  3. JavaScript:精通JavaScript,熟悉ES6及以上新特性,了解异步编程、模块化开发等,熟悉主流JavaScript框架如Vue、React、Angular等。

  4. 前端框架:熟悉至少一种主流前端框架,如Vue、React、Angular等,具备框架搭建和组件开发能力。

  5. 版本控制:熟练使用Git进行版本控制,了解分支管理、代码合并等操作。

  6. 前端性能优化:了解前端性能优化策略,如代码压缩、图片优化、懒加载等。

  7. 跨平台开发:了解跨平台开发技术,如React Native、Flutter等。

二、项目经验要求

  1. 参与过至少1个完整的前端项目开发,具备独立开发能力

  2. 熟悉前后端分离的开发模式,了解RESTful API设计原则

  3. 具备前端性能优化经验,能够针对项目进行性能调优

  4. 熟悉主流前端构建工具,如Webpack、Gulp等

  5. 具备移动端开发经验,了解响应式设计、Hybrid App等

三、软技能要求

  1. 良好的沟通能力,能够与团队成员、产品经理、UI设计师等有效沟通

  2. 具备团队合作精神,能够适应快节奏的工作环境

  3. 具备较强的学习能力和解决问题的能力,能够快速掌握新技术

  4. 具备良好的代码规范和文档编写能力

  5. 关注前端发展趋势,关注行业动态,不断学习新知识

案例分析:

以某知名互联网公司为例,该公司招聘Web前端工程师时,对技术栈的要求如下:

  1. HTML5、CSS3、JavaScript:要求熟练掌握,具备扎实的理论基础。

  2. 前端框架:要求熟悉至少一种主流前端框架,如Vue、React等。

  3. 项目经验:要求具备至少1个完整的前端项目开发经验,熟悉前后端分离的开发模式。

  4. 软技能:要求具备良好的沟通能力、团队合作精神、学习能力和解决问题的能力。

综上所述,上海知名企业招聘Web前端工程师时,对技术栈、项目经验、软技能等方面都有较高的要求。作为一名Web前端工程师,要想在激烈的竞争中脱颖而出,需要不断提升自己的综合素质,紧跟行业发展趋势。

猜你喜欢:猎头如何快速推人